Mysql中的in和find_in_set的区别?

2023-05-16

1.是否使用索引

  • find_in_set:不使用索引,是全表扫描
  • in:使用索引

2.使用方法 

在mysql中in的使用情况如下(in里面放的是常量):
select * from article where 列名 in(值1,值2,值3…);
select * from article where 值1 in(值1,值2,值3…);

在mysql中find_in_set的使用情况如下(find_in_set可以放常量也可以放变量):
select * from article where find_in_set(值1, ‘值1,值2,值3…’);
select * from article where find_in_set(列名, ‘值1,值2,值3…’);
select * from article where find_in_set(值1, 列名);
 

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Mysql中的in和find_in_set的区别? 的相关文章

随机推荐

  • 【无标题】前端工程师面试题手册-有点长但是很有用

    不是原作者 想想要获取更多前端开发相关学习资料 xff0c 请加微信1124692领取 前端工程师面试题手册 目录 1 前端基础 11 1 1 HTTP HTML 浏览器
  • 超详细的VMware虚拟机安装Linux图文教程保姆级

    目录 一 下载VMware 二 安装VMware 三 下载Linux 四 安装Linux 五 设置本地机与虚拟机之间的数据传输 xff08 复制 粘贴等操作 xff09 一 下载VMware VMware官网有两个版本 xff0c 分别是
  • 仿牛客技术博客项目常见问题及解答(三)

    书接上回 xff1a 仿牛客技术博客项目常见问题及解答 xff08 二 xff09 李孛欢的博客 CSDN博客 13 项目中的kafka是怎么用的 xff1f kafka入门 Apache Kafka是一个分布式流平台 一个分布式的流平台应
  • [Java] 继承 和 多态(学习总结)

    目录 继承 一 继承主要表示概念层上的 is a 的关系 二 什么是继承 三 语法 四 继承方式 xff1a 五 访问权限 六 构造方法 七 父类的属性和方法的访问 八 重载和重写 xff08 前提是子类是有权限的 xff09 九 执行顺序
  • 第七章-X86汇编语言从实模式到保护模式

    第七章 比高斯更快的计算 7 3 显示字符串 39 1 43 2 43 3 43 43 100 61 39 字符串编译阶段 xff0c 编译器将把它们拆开 xff0c 形成一个个单独的字节jump near start跳过没有指令的数据区1
  • 【java】杂七杂八的基础知识

    1 当用javac命令编译Java源程序 xff08 java文件 xff09 时 xff0c 必须写出该源文件的完整文件名 xff0c 包括扩展名 java 2 当用java exe命令运行一个字节码 class 文件时 xff0c 不必
  • 论文笔记 Pruning neural networks without any databy iteratively conserving synaptic flow

    摘要 修剪神经网络的参数可以在训练和测试期间节省时间 内存和能量 最近的研究发现 xff0c 通过一系列昂贵的训练和修剪周期 xff0c 初始化时存在中奖彩票或稀疏可训练的子网络 这就提出一个基本问题 xff1a 我们能否在初始化时识别出高
  • 常见通信协议-原理篇

    目录 前言通信协议分类1 串行与并行通信2 同步与异步通信3 串行通信数据传送方向常见通信方式分类不同分类协议需要额外处理的问题 各通信协议详解一 UART 通用异步收发器 1 接口连接方式2 帧格式波特率 二 IIC 集成电路总线 1 接
  • 树莓派安装ubuntu20.04、图形桌面、ROS笔记

    目录标题 1 安装ubuntu方式1 xff1a 树莓派镜像烧录器方式2 xff1a win32 Disk Imager 烧录软件 2 添加wifi方式一 network config文件方式二 50 cloud init yaml文件 x
  • Git 常用命令

    git 注 xff1a 在使用的任何的 git 命令前 xff0c 都要切换到 git 项目目录下 git init 初始化一个 git 仓库 git status 查看当前 git 仓库的状态 git add file 修改 file 文
  • 字符串查找函数strstr,strtok的详细介绍

    strstr 返回str2在str1中第一次出现的指针 xff0c 如果str2不是str1的一部分 xff0c 则返回空指针str1 xff08 简单来说就是在字符串里找子字符串 xff09 可以看到上图strstr函数找到子串后会把剩余
  • 实现Windows远程连接

    此方法不止局限于局域网内 xff0c 只要被控制端的电脑连接上了互联网 xff0c 那么在任意一个电脑上都可以连接 话不多说直接上干货 xff01 xff01 xff01 配置被控制端电脑 一 开启远程桌面访问功能 不是windwos专业版
  • Jetpack Compose 不止是一个UI框架~

    Jetpack Compose是用于构建原生Android UI的现代工具包 Jetpack Compose使用更少的代码 xff0c 强大的工具和直观的Kotlin API xff0c 简化并加速了Android上的UI开发 这是Andr
  • 父类和子类方法的调用

    由于没有找到想要的解释 xff0c 于是自己就在idea上自测来寻找答案 关于父类 xff0c 子类 xff0c 多态之间方法的调用 package 思考 public class 子类调用 public static void main
  • vector介绍与使用(C++)

    目录 一 vector的介绍 二 vector的使用 2 1构造函数 2 2vector iterator 的使用 2 3vector 空间增长问题 2 4 vector 增删查改 2 5 vector 迭代器失效问题 一 vector的介
  • 网络层——IP协议详细解读

    文章目录 IP协议1 IP协议的报文格式2 IP协议的地址管理3 IP地址的组成4 IP协议的路由选择 IP协议 之前介绍了传输层的重点协议 xff0c TCP和UDP协议 xff0c 以下将介绍网络层的重点协议IP协议 1 IP协议的报文
  • 基于opencv实现追踪物体的功能

    nbsp nbsp nbsp nbsp nbsp nbsp nbsp nbsp From sztu 自动化专业的小菜鸡 nbsp nbsp nbsp nbsp nbsp nbsp nbsp nbsp 本篇将介绍计算机视觉的物体追踪 基于py
  • PX4源码中CMakeLists.txt文件的相关含义

    在px4每个模块中 xff0c 都会引用到CMakeLists txt文件 比如 代码 px4 add module MODULE modules attitude estimator q MAIN attitude estimator q
  • 位置式Pid和增量式Pid的定义及应用

    PID算法是一个典型的闭环控制系统 P I D xff0c 比例 积分 微分 开环 xff1a 输入量对输出量没有反馈作用 xff1b 闭环 xff1a 输入量对输出量有反馈作用 位置式Pid 位置式Pid就是位置闭环控制 xff0c 位置
  • Mysql中的in和find_in_set的区别?

    1 是否使用索引 find in set xff1a 不使用索引 xff0c 是全表扫描in xff1a 使用索引 2 使用方法 在mysql中in的使用情况如下 xff08 in里面放的是常量 xff09 xff1a select fro